aboutsummaryrefslogtreecommitdiffstats
path: root/tools
diff options
context:
space:
mode:
authorFelix Fietkau <nbd@openwrt.org>2009-12-16 13:47:47 +0000
committerFelix Fietkau <nbd@openwrt.org>2009-12-16 13:47:47 +0000
commitf7ebcedcc2c516005ce34e08732dfecc88d88b25 (patch)
tree2bdcb2e572de262091407c85b2ac308d8cba1328 /tools
parent4799f6db8840a971d7edbced706095dae5c29b1e (diff)
downloadupstream-f7ebcedcc2c516005ce34e08732dfecc88d88b25.tar.gz
upstream-f7ebcedcc2c516005ce34e08732dfecc88d88b25.tar.bz2
upstream-f7ebcedcc2c516005ce34e08732dfecc88d88b25.zip
wrt350nv2-builder: increase path limit from 64 bytes to 256 bytes, as 64 bytes may not be enough. suggested by maddes
git-svn-id: svn://svn.openwrt.org/openwrt/trunk@18794 3c298f89-4303-0410-b956-a3cf2f4a3e73
Diffstat (limited to 'tools')
-rw-r--r--tools/wrt350nv2-builder/src/wrt350nv2-builder.c10
1 files changed, 5 insertions, 5 deletions
diff --git a/tools/wrt350nv2-builder/src/wrt350nv2-builder.c b/tools/wrt350nv2-builder/src/wrt350nv2-builder.c
index 784f921547..36932863af 100644
--- a/tools/wrt350nv2-builder/src/wrt350nv2-builder.c
+++ b/tools/wrt350nv2-builder/src/wrt350nv2-builder.c
@@ -187,8 +187,8 @@ int parse_par_file(FILE *f_par) {
int lineno;
int count;
- char string1[64];
- char string2[64];
+ char string1[256];
+ char string2[256];
int value;
mtd_info *mtd;
@@ -257,7 +257,7 @@ int parse_par_file(FILE *f_par) {
// split line if starting with a colon
switch (line[0]) {
case ':':
- count = sscanf(line, ":%63s %i %63s", string1, &value, string2);
+ count = sscanf(line, ":%255s %i %255s", string1, &value, string2);
if (count != 3) {
printf("line %i does not meet defined format (:<mtdname> <mtdsize> <file>)\n", lineno);
} else {
@@ -316,7 +316,7 @@ int parse_par_file(FILE *f_par) {
}
break;
case '#': // integer values
- count = sscanf(line, "#%63s %i", string1, &value);
+ count = sscanf(line, "#%255s %i", string1, &value);
if (count != 2) {
printf("line %i does not meet defined format (:<variable name> <integer>\n", lineno);
} else {
@@ -332,7 +332,7 @@ int parse_par_file(FILE *f_par) {
}
break;
case '$': // strings
- count = sscanf(line, "$%63s %63s", string1, string2);
+ count = sscanf(line, "$%255s %255s", string1, string2);
if (count != 2) {
printf("line %i does not meet defined format (:<mtdname> <mtdsize> <file>)\n", lineno);
} else {